Abstract

It floats the present invention relates to a kind of elevator and jacks positioning mechanism, comprising: fixed plate: be mounted in ground base;Pin assembly in fixed plate is set: being used for the positioning pin unit of precise positioning workpiece including several groups;It is arranged in fixed plate and is located at two groups of floating ball components of pin assembly two sides: including the supporting element being fixed in fixed plate, the jacking unit that is arranged on supporting element and can move up and down along the vertical direction, is mounted on the floating ball mounting plate on jacking unit top, and is arranged at least one floating ball unit of floating ball mounting plate upper surface.Compared with prior art, the present invention can reduce the fierceness as caused by dislocation and shake, and improve positioning accuracy, increase the service life of positioning device, increase economic efficiency.

Background technique
LNG ship polyurethane insulating case, cabinet by glued board and cystosepiment by way of industrial glue it is glued and At since its outer dimension requires strictly, it is necessary to be constrained with tension device it, be prevented due to transporting after the completion of gluing Shake or other reasons in journey lead to the dislocation between glued board and cystosepiment.
The automation suit of tension device is the key that solve the problems, such as entire glue line, and existing production line is in process In, tension device passes through first to be manually inserted in tension device pallet, subsequently through logistics and robot realize tension device suit and Disassembly.The positioning of pallet becomes one of the difficult point of entire glue line, and what traditional solution was taken is sensor positioning Mode, there are the following problems for which:
1. under traditional positioning method positioning scenarios, to processing signal, there are certain delay situations from signal is obtained for sensor And wow and flutter of the servo in its stopped process leads to its stop position and ideal position in the actual operation process There is certain deviation, so only positioning by sensors in place, positioning accuracy is not reached requirement.
2. traditional positioning method, after sensor stops again by positioning pin by way of carry out being directed into set installation and dismantling Movement is unloaded, since positioning accuracy is inadequate, vibration is easy to appear in position fixing process, tension device is will lead to and is shifted on pallet;It is special Be not when deviation is larger, or at all into not positioning pin, cause to have to during automatically grabbing people participates in could be normal Movement, greatly reduces assembly efficiency.
3. traditional positioning method, since positioning accuracy not enough results in the need for manually participating in, on the one hand since personnel enter certainly Dynamicization producing line is unfavorable for protecting safety of workers, on the other hand, manually participates in solving while also reducing after there is orientation problem Production efficiency generates strong influence to the production capacity of sliver.

A kind of elevator floating jacking positioning mechanism, comprising:
Fixed plate: it is mounted in ground base;
Pin assembly in fixed plate is set: being used for the positioning pin unit of precise positioning workpiece including several groups;
It is arranged in fixed plate and is located at two groups of floating ball components of pin assembly two sides: including being fixed in fixed plate Supporting element, is mounted on the floating of jacking unit top at the jacking unit that is arranged on supporting element and can move up and down along the vertical direction Ball mounting plate, and it is arranged at least one floating ball unit of floating ball mounting plate upper surface.
Further, the positioning pin unit includes the height regulating rod being mounted in fixed plate and setting in height The tapered sleeve on adjusting rod top.
Further, the tapered sleeve is pyramidal structure thick under upper point, and taper is 1:1.5~2.2.
Further, the size of height regulating rod and tapered sleeve meets: when jacking unit rises to extreme higher position, floating ball The height of unit is lower than the height on tapered sleeve top;When jacking unit drops to extreme lower position, the height of floating ball unit is lower than cone Cover the height of lowermost end.
Further, the lower surface of tapered sleeve is connect by multiple lock screws with height regulating rod, and lock screw is preferred Using four, the flatness of tapered sleeve can be finely tuned by adjusting lock screw.
Further, the jacking unit includes the jacking cylinder being mounted on supporting element, the output of the jacking cylinder End is also connected with the floating ball mounting plate, and floating ball mounting plate is driven to move up and down along the vertical direction.
Further, the pilot hole penetrated through along the vertical direction is also processed on supporting element, is equipped in the pilot hole along it The guide rod slided up and down, the upper end of the guide rod are fixedly connected with the floating ball mounting plate.Guide rod is preferably distributed in jacking Cylinder two sides, are symmetric, and on the one hand reduce cylinder by the effect of radial force, on the one hand play the guiding role.
Further, the floating ball unit include the cage being arranged on floating ball mounting plate, be rotatably arranged in cage and The positioning floating ball that upper part is exposed.
Further, the damping piece contacted with the positioning floating ball surface is additionally provided in cage.In the present invention, damping Part is the element for applying certain pivoting friction resistance after contacting with positioning floating ball surface to it.
Still more preferably, it is 0.4~0.6 that damping piece, which meets its coefficient of friction between positioning floating ball,.
In practical work process, elevator is in extreme lower position always, when tension device is in pallet-free shape using position It (needs to see empty pallet off by lower layer's logistics when tension device is in empty pallet state using position, lower layer's logistics roller when state Road face height need to be higher than positioning pin top 30mm or more), after elevator obtains climb command, elevator runs to upper layer and fills support Disk position.Full tray in place after, elevator obtain decline instruction, elevator wait float jacking positioning mechanism rising in place, After floating ball mechanism cylinder rises in place, issuing signal in place, (positioning surface of floating ball unit is lower than positioning pin cell location face at this time 10mm-15mm, main purpose be prevent from causing due to installation accuracy problem all floating balls not in same level so as to Cause pallet that uncontrolled movement occurs in floating ball mechanism), elevator is begun to decline at this time, liter when close to floating ball mechanism Drop machine runs slowly to extreme lower position and issues signal in place, and floating ball mechanism obtains elevator in place after signal, begins to decline dynamic Make, signal is completed in sending movement after two sides cylinder is fallen into place, and system starts tension device and uses process.Tension device on pallet makes After being finished, elevator rises to lower layer's logistics raceway position, and empty tension device pallet is seen off by logistics, after the completion of movement, rises Drop machine continues to rise to upper layer and fills tray position, then repeats the above process.
Compared with prior art, the invention has the following advantages that
(1) being provided with for floating ball unit is conducive to improve the stability in position error larger adjustment, reduces due to dislocation Caused by fierceness shake, improve positioning accuracy, increase the service life of positioning device, increase economic efficiency.
(2) floating positioning unit is used, is reduced since the positioning accuracy difference band of elevator carrys out system accuracy shakiness It is qualitative, a possibility that reducing system jam, economic benefit is improved, strong support is provided for large-scale production.
(3) the superfluous of system is considerably increased using the location hole of large aperture low-angle and positioning pin unit matching on workpiece Yu Xing reduces the influence being not allowed due to elevator chain structure positioning, reduces failure rate, improves production efficiency.
